- // <array>
- // template <size_t I, class T, size_t N> T& get(array<T, N>& a);
- #include <array>
- #include <cassert>
- #include "test_macros.h"
- // std::array is explicitly allowed to be initialized with A a = { init-list };.
- // Disable the missing braces warning for this reason.
- #include "disable_missing_braces_warning.h"
- #if TEST_STD_VER > 11
- struct S {
- std::array<int, 3> a;
- int k;
- constexpr S() : a{1,2,3}, k(std::get<2>(a)) {}
- };
- constexpr std::array<int, 2> getArr () { return { 3, 4 }; }
- #endif
- int main(int, char**)
- {
- {
- typedef double T;
- typedef std::array<T, 3> C;
- C c = {1, 2, 3.5};
- std::get<1>(c) = 5.5;
- assert(c[0] == 1);
- assert(c[1] == 5.5);
- assert(c[2] == 3.5);
- }
- #if TEST_STD_VER > 11
- {
- typedef double T;
- typedef std::array<T, 3> C;
- constexpr C c = {1, 2, 3.5};
- static_assert(std::get<0>(c) == 1, "");
- static_assert(std::get<1>(c) == 2, "");
- static_assert(std::get<2>(c) == 3.5, "");
- }
- {
- static_assert(S().k == 3, "");
- static_assert(std::get<1>(getArr()) == 4, "");
- }
- #endif
- return 0;
- }
